Livestock Dealer Licensing

How to Get a Livestock Dealer or Market Agency License

Who must be licensed?

Anyone, including meat packing companies, who engages in the business of buying or selling livestock on a regular basis. Livestock includes:

  • Cattle
  • Sheep
  • Swine
  • Horses intended for slaughter
  • Mules
  • Farmed cervidae (deer & elk)
  • Llamas
  • Ratitae (ostriches & emus)
  • Bison
  • Goats

You do not need a license if you:

  • are primarily a meat retailer,
  • operate a frozen food processing plant, or
  • raise livestock, and the animals you buy are for herd replacement and you sell only livestock you bred and/or raised yourself.

Anyone who buys and sells livestock for their own business or on the behalf of others must be registered and bonded by the USDA and licensed by the MDA.


Rules: 1515.0100 - .2400

Statutes: 17A.04

Apply for a license

  1. First, contact the USDA Packers and Stockyards Administration office in Des Moines, Iowa at 515-323-2579. They will send you the paperwork you need to become registered and bonded.
  2. Once you have obtained a bond, the USDA will notify MDA.
  3. Once MDA has heard from the USDA, we’ll send you the forms to apply for the appropriate license. You can also download the application form from this page or complete it online.
    However, the MDA cannot issue your license until the Packers and Stockyards registration/bonding is complete.

License fees

  • $300 for each livestock market agency and public stockyard
  • $100 for each livestock dealer
  • $100 for each meat packing company
  • $50 for each agent of a livestock dealer or meat packing company

It usually takes about two weeks for us to issue a license once we receive all the paperwork, so please plan ahead. If you have questions about the requirements or licensing process, please contact us.

Renewing a license

Each year MDA will mail out a renewal notice with a new PIN. Contact us MDA if you don't know your current PIN.
